Output d8387867762ed32d49e7f78d4cea68e4d10c84dfc3a9cd08f1bbac7d8081a615:1

value
8689607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e822c7f4b31a511e7a336172da7693cdce979cc3 OP_EQUAL
address
3NrSMgPw1bjG65SPfruchPVv2mzp2Sry7u
transaction
d8387867762ed32d49e7f78d4cea68e4d10c84dfc3a9cd08f1bbac7d8081a615
spent
true